在網頁開發中,我們經常會用到按鈕來進行交互。而在使用javascript來編寫按鈕代碼時,有時候會遇到按鈕亂碼的問題。這種情況下,按鈕上的文字無法正常顯示,給用戶帶來了很不好的體驗。那么,為什么會出現按鈕亂碼的問題?如何解決這個問題呢?下面我們來一一探討。
首先,我們需要了解的是,按鈕亂碼的問題主要是由于編碼格式的不兼容所導致的。比如,在使用ascii碼時,中文字符就會出現亂碼的情況。此外,瀏覽器也會影響按鈕文字的顯示,不同的瀏覽器對于編碼格式的處理方式也會有所區別。
接下來,我們來看一下解決按鈕亂碼問題的方法。一般來說,我們可以通過以下兩種方法來解決這個問題。
方法一:使用Unicode編碼
<input type="button" value="\u63d0\u4ea4" />
該方法將按鈕上的文字用Unicode編碼表示,通過加上"\u"字符來轉義。這樣就不會出現由于編碼格式不兼容導致的按鈕亂碼問題了。同時,該方法也具有兼容性較好的特點,適用于各種不同的瀏覽器環境。
方法二:設置編碼格式為UTF-8
<meta http-equiv="Content-Type" content="text/html; charset=UTF-8"> <input type="button" value="提交" />
該方法需要在HTML文檔中自行設置編碼格式為UTF-8。這樣一來,瀏覽器就會按照UTF-8編碼格式來解析內容,避免了因編碼格式不兼容導致的亂碼問題。但需要注意的是,該方法有可能與某些瀏覽器不兼容,需要根據具體情況調整。
總的來說,按鈕亂碼是javascript編寫中比較常見的問題之一,解決方法也比較簡單。通過使用Unicode編碼或者設置編碼格式為UTF-8,我們就可以很好地解決按鈕亂碼問題,提高用戶體驗。
上一篇php jave
下一篇mysql與oracle